Marstel-Day's newest partner - Juli macDonald-Wimbush

Fredericksburg, VA (Vocus) May 6, 2009

Environmental and international security consulting firm Marstel-Day, LLC today announced the significant enhancement of its international program capabilities this week with the addition of Ms. Juli MacDonald-Wimbush as a new Partner in the firm.

Company President Rebecca R. Rubin said: “We are delighted to announce that Juli has joined Marstel-Day as a new principal with our company. She is the right person to help us enhance the reach of our international practice, especially with the growing, global interest in the intersection of energy and security policy issues. Juli has extensive international experience, and has led international research teams working in Eurasia, South Asia and the Asia-Pacific region. She is known for her work on Asian energy security, about which she has authored a number of policy studies and monographs, most notably several important studies on Chinese and Indian energy security strategies for Defense and Intelligence Community clients. She also led, for the National Intelligence Council, a strategic assessment of future competition in Asia for non-energy resources.”

MacDonald-Wimbush joined Marstel-Day on May 1 after a distinguished career at the global consulting firm Booz Allen Hamilton, where she managed principal parts of its intelligence analysis market and the important future strategy account for the Director of Net Assessment of the Office of the Secretary of Defense. For the latter, she designed and led many "alternative futures" exercises and analyses that sought to understand the trajectories and dynamics of emerging political, economic, environmental, and social trends for national security and defense planners.

Prior to joining Booz Allen, Ms. MacDonald-Wimbush was a Senior Analyst for Science Applications International Corporation (SAIC) where she organized analytical studies and exercises for commercial and government clients. At SAIC, she was the primary author of a series of studies exploring the consequences of environmental breakdowns and dysfunctions for national security and defense planning. For private sector clients, including major international energy companies, she was the principal author of a number of “challenge and opportunity” assessments.

Ms. MacDonald-Wimbush holds an MSc in International Political Economy from the London School of Economics and Political Science and a B.A. in International Relations from the University of the Pacific. She also studied at the Karl Franzens University in Graz, Austria, and at the Friedrich Willhelm University in Bonn, Germany.
